B1036-19-WINDOW LIFTER SWITCHES ENABLE - OVER CURRENT
For a complete wiring diagram, refer to the Wiring Information.
Theory of Operation
The Body Control Module (BCM) supplies an ignition switch output circuit to the window switches. This circuit is called the Window Switch Supply circuit. If there is a short to ground or over current on this circuit, the internal relay will open up thereby protecting the BCM from damage. Once the over current is removed the circuit will return to normal by cycling the ignition from on to off then back on. This circuit is also used for the window switch lamp illumination.
- When Monitored:
Anytime the body control module is awake.
- Set Condition:
When the Body Control Module (BCM) detects a low condition on the Window Switch Enable circuit.
1. INTERMITTENT CONDITION
1. Turn the ignition on.
2. With the scan tool, record and erase the DTCs.
3. Try to operate the driver and then the passenger power windows several times.
4. With the scan tool, read the active DTCs.
Does the scan tool display: B1036-19-WINDOW LIFTER SWITCHES ENABLE - OVER CURRENT?
Yes
- Go To 2
No
- Test complete, the condition or conditions that originally set this DTC are not present at this time. Using the wiring diagrams as a guide, check all related splices and connectors for signs of water intrusion, corrosion, pushed out or bent terminals, and correct pin tension.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
2. ELIMINATE PASSENGER SIDE
1. With the scan tool, record and erase the DTCs.
2. Turn the ignition off.
3. Disconnect the Passenger Power Window Switch harness connector.
4. Turn the ignition on.
5. Try to operate the Driver Power Window several times.
6. With the scan tool, read the active DTCs.
Does the scan tool display; B1036-19-WINDOW LIFTER SWITCHES ENABLE - OVER CURRENT?
Yes
- Go To 3
No
- Go To 7
3. CHECK THE WINDOW SWITCH SUPPLY CIRCUIT FOR A SHORT TO GROUND
1. Turn the ignition off.
2. Disconnect the Driver Power Window Switch harness connector.
3. Measure the resistance between ground and the Window Switch Supply circuit (Cavity 4).
Is the resistance below 3.0K Ohms?
Yes
- Go To 4
No
- Go To 5
4. CHECK THE BODY CONTROL MODULE FOR A SHORT TO GROUND
1. Disconnect the Body Control Module C3 harness connector.
2. Measure the resistance between ground and the Window Switch Supply circuit (Cavity 4) in the Driver Power Window Switch harness connector.
Is the resistance below 3.0K Ohms?
Yes
- Repair the short to ground in the Window Switch Supply circuit between the BCM C3 harness connector and the Driver or Passenger Window Switch harness connectors.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
No
- Replace the BCM. Body Control Module - Removal.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
5. CHECK THE WINDOW SWITCH UP/DOWN SENSE CIRCUITS FOR A SHORT TO GROUND
1. Measure the resistance between ground and the (Q337) Driver Window Switch Sense (Up) circuit (Cavity 1) in the Driver Power Window Switch harness connector.
2. Measure the resistance between ground and the (Q339) Driver Window Switch Sense (Down) circuit (Cavity 2) in the Driver Power Window Switch harness connector.
Is the resistance below 1000.0 Ohms in either or both circuits?
Yes
- Go To 6
No
- Replace the Driver Power Window Switch. Power Window Switch - Removal
- Perform the BODY VERIFICATION TEST. Body Verification Test.
6. CHECK THE BODY CONTROL MODULE FOR A SHORT TO GROUND
1. Disconnect the Body Control Module C3 harness connector.
2. Measure the resistance between ground and the (Q337) Driver Window Switch Sense (Up) circuit (Cavity 1) in the Driver Power Window Switch harness connector.
3. Measure the resistance between ground and the (Q339) Driver Window Switch Sense (Down) circuit (Cavity 2) in the Driver Power Window Switch harness connector.
Is the resistance below 1000.0 Ohms in either or both circuits?
Yes
- Repair the short to ground in the appropriate Driver Window Switch Sense circuit.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
No
- Replace the Body Control Module.Body Control Module - Removal.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
7. CHECK THE WINDOW SWITCH UP/DOWN SIGNAL CIRCUITS FOR A SHORT TO GROUND
1. Measure the resistance between ground and the (Q0340) Passenger Window Switch Sense (Up) circuit (Cavity 1) in the Passenger Power Window Switch harness connector.
2. Measure the resistance between ground and the (Q338) Passenger Window Switch Sense (Down) circuit (Cavity 2) in the Passenger Power Window Switch harness connector.
Is the resistance below 1000.0 Ohms in either or both circuits?
Yes
- Go To 8
No
- Replace the Passenger Power Window Switch. Power Window Switch - Removal.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
8. CHECK THE BODY CONTROL MODULE FOR A SHORT TO GROUND
1. Disconnect the Body Control Module C3 harness connector.
2. Measure the resistance between ground and the (Q0340) Passenger Window Switch Sense (Up) circuit (Cavity 1) in the Passenger Power Window Switch harness connector.
3. Measure the resistance between ground and the (Q338) Passenger Window Switch Sense (Down) circuit (Cavity 2) in the Passenger Power Window Switch harness connector.
Is the resistance below 1000.0 Ohms in either or both circuits?
Yes
- Repair the short to ground in the appropriate Passenger Window Switch Sense circuit.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
No
- Replace the Body Control Module.Body Control Module - Removal.
- Perform the BODY VERIFICATION TEST. Body Verification Test.
